Based Rock and Roll

Verified contract

Active on Base with 1,618 txns
Deployed by via 0x7081ee5f at 3857371
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
ERC-20
--
0x637fce9608cac10038550f01f822c39b3847adcd5dd471f72c2feb0eb417555c
0x17058a1599bf072356b04d982412f921071af1d4cb0da6c89b3cac452d2ecdef
0x491dedd531e504536af0c3760fa0e10c39d7119644f127e6ac5647c90468b493
0x939886c526106ba59c1646156b9bb1a8d17bfe4bb6a60a84186e6f4bf7f18e35
0xfe774d88ea7f459fac2cbfacc000a6f3e57b94eb53cc2d101870d67807a97746
0xa0642bb6d608b18c289ae036500c06e95692fa07f45f718e1eb7eca7c495d55b
0xb0d8cc65d8a8957bebfe62d3c848e90203a733108208dff93bb691a38cf08ca9
0x5e0b183c143a9a5a0f2cce43ac1692de47d738fe4eb69260cad63e4a65e347f8
0x46c423c03fd50a930acb205d6056f2deec9bc8e38669cd5e8d37fa532ad24995
0x7ff0258724202ddf3b604044e838f16171c6b75d524a4bc849b04360a52bf81d

Functions
Getter at block 22759840
COST(view returns (uint256)
500000000000000
MAX_FREE(view returns (uint256)
3333
MAX_FREE_PER_WALLET(view returns (uint256)
1
MAX_SUPPLY(view returns (uint256)
3333
name(view returns (string)
Based Rock and Roll
owner(view returns (address)
0xbd686bfa19789582e54a27d75e4d8084ca322244
symbol(view returns (string)
RockNroll
totalSupply(view returns (uint256)
1545
Read-only
balanceOf(address ownerview returns (uint256)
getApproved(uint256 tokenIdview returns (address)
isApprovedForAll(address owneraddress operatorview returns (bool)
ownerOf(uint256 tokenIdview returns (address)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enURI(uint256 tokenIdview returns (string)
State-modifying
approve(address touint256 tokenId
freeMint(
mint(uint256 amountpayable 
safeTransferFrom(address fromaddress touint256 tokenId
safeTransferFrom(address fromaddress touint256 tokenIdbytes _data
setApprovalForAll(address operatorbool approved
setConfig(uint256 _MAX_FREEuint256 _COSTuint256 _MAX_FREE_PER_WALLET
setData(string _base
transferFrom(address fromaddress touint256 tokenId
withdraw(
Events
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
ConsecutiveTransfer(uint256 indexed fromTokenIduint256 toTokenIdaddress indexed fromaddress indexed to
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
Constructor
constructor(
Fallback and receive

This contract contains no fallback and receive objects.

Errors
ApprovalCallerNotOwnerNorApproved(
ApprovalQueryForNonexistentToken(
ApproveToCaller(
BalanceQueryForZeroAddress(
MintERC2309QuantityExceedsLimit(
MintToZeroAddress(
MintZeroQuantity(
OwnerQueryForNonexistentToken(
OwnershipNotInitializedForExtraData(
TransferCallerNotOwnerNorApproved(
TransferFromIncorrectOwner(
TransferToNonERC721ReceiverImplementer(
TransferToZeroAddress(
URIQueryForNonexistentToken(